The scent of salt and sun-warmed sand fills the air as the first rays of dawn paint the vast expanse of Abd al Kuri North Coast Beach. Stretching for miles beyond the small settlement of Kilmia, this sandy shoreline is Socotra's primary northern beach-bearing stretch, a testament to the island's untouched allure. OnlyBeaches rates this Tier 2 discovery with an OBI score of 7.8, recognizing its significant natural beauty and secluded charm.
What makes Abd al Kuri so distinctive is its sheer scale and raw, undeveloped character. Unlike more accessible shores, this beach offers an immersive experience in nature, where the only sounds are the gentle rhythm of the waves and the occasional call of a seabird. The sand is a soft, pale gold, inviting long barefoot strolls. The waters, typically calm and clear along this northern coast, are ideal for a refreshing swim, offering a tranquil embrace after a morning of exploration. Sun bathing here feels like a private indulgence, with ample space to find your own secluded spot.

Yes, the waters along this northern coast are typically calm and clear, making them suitable for swimming.
Generally, the cooler, drier months from October to May offer the most pleasant weather for visiting Socotra's beaches.
Access is typically by 4x4 vehicle from Kilmia, navigating along the island's north coast roads.

As a remote and hidden beach, Abd al Kuri North Coast Beach has no developed facilities; visitors should come prepared.
While there are no official restrictions, visitors are encouraged to keep dogs leashed and clean up after them to preserve the natural environment.
The small settlement of Kilmia is the closest point, offering a glimpse into local life on Socotra island.
